Carpet featuring Scotchgard protection should
stay clean 2 to 3 times longer than similar untreated
carpet; providing a better appearance with less cleaning.
Professional hot water extraction cleaning is the preferred
method because it leaves the least amount of detergent
residue. If you choose to do-it-yourself, DO NOT
use wet shampoo equipment. Shampooing can leave a soap
residue in the carpet, which masks the Scotchgard protection
& attracts & holds dirt. Frequency of cleaning The
warranty requires your carpet to be hot water extraction
cleaned at least once every two years by Certified carpet
cleaners. Reapplying Scotchgard protector always
enhances the amount of protection. It is important that
you retain your cleaning receipts in the event that you
need to make a warranty claim. Areas of higher traffic
& soiling should be hot water extraction cleaned more
frequently.
Do-it-yourself methods. Proper carpet cleaning
requires experience & special equipment. Most rental
or home cleaning equipment is unable to extract thoroughly
the water & detergents they put into the carpet. Left
in the carpet, the detergents attract more dirt, causing
rapid re-soiling & the need for re-cleaning. Professional
hot water extraction is the method 3M requires for your
carpet. Hot water extraction This is the best
method for deep-cleaning most carpets which requires the
use of a machine which sprays cleaning solution into the
carpet pile. Chemicals attack the soil and greasy build-up
on the carpet fibers. A powerful vacuum then extracts
the solution immediately. For optimal soil and stain protection,
3M recommends that Scotchgard protector be reapplied after
every hot water extraction. 3M recommends using a reputable
professional cleaner.
